• MENU

Embedded Software

embeddedLinwave offers an Embedded Software Development service for real-time and critical applications. We have experience in the following microcontroller and microprocessor platforms:

  • Microchip© PIC 10/12/16/17/18/24(16bit)/32(32bit) series microcontrollers
  • Dallas/Maxim© TINI & 80C390/80C400
  • ARM© 7TDMI
  • Intel© (and variant) 8051 series
  • Embedded PC x86 platforms
  • Xilinx© CPLD’s with Foundation tools

Our software is thoroughly tested to ensure a robust and stable platform for your requirements. The modular nature of the software allows later expansion of the code to match a customer’s increasing demands and reduces code duplication between applications. Typical applications of our Embedded Software include:

  • RF detector linearisation
  • Monitor and control functions over RF and fibre-optic links
  • Antenna pan and tilt control
  • Advanced control of RF electronic counter-measures
  • Industrial instrumentation
  • Low speed AFSK modems
  • SPI/I2C chip initialisation and control
  • Environmental monitoring and control
  • USB, RS-232/422/485, ethernet and fibre communications
  • High speed multi-band synthesizer control
  • Web-enabled devices (HTTP/Telnet/FTP)
  • Thermal managment systems
  • Serial language/code translation

We also use the following programming languages.

  • C/C++/Embedded C
  • Assembler (largely in time-critical Microchip PIC applications)
  • National Instruments LabView
  • Perl Scripting, PHP and MySQL